Output 325abbb4de24990371d6342e16aeb6a53aa333d2bd9286d998be231059517099:1

value
901503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ebe2c0c5ac57c6569271a26b0a280d446d43b57 OP_EQUAL
address
34Va1ghZ85UfK7xV1mXRgWehqc6eWeoLFv
transaction
325abbb4de24990371d6342e16aeb6a53aa333d2bd9286d998be231059517099
spent
true